Given:
Christopher scores 2 goals in a soccer game.
His goal total can vary from the average by 1 goal.
To find:
The absolute value equation can be used to calculate Christopher's maximum and minimum goals per game.
Solution:
Let Christopher scores x goals in a soccer game.
Then difference between actual goals and average goals is x-2.
His goal total can vary from the average by 1 goal.
Maximum number of goals = 2+1 = 3
Minimum number of goals = 2-1 = 1
It means, the difference between actual goals and average goals is either -1 and 1.
